Output 52dfcb109f0353943e41d75efbd436c7016f1edfe95f6a73600733bea275fd50:28

value
304818773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f8d9458cbe7cc82b7de48d60decdea719933e36 OP_EQUAL
address
38weup7T2jptxKRLPWeq7b7sUEp33PcDCG
transaction
52dfcb109f0353943e41d75efbd436c7016f1edfe95f6a73600733bea275fd50
spent
true